What factors should I consider when selecting a football?

Consider the material and construction when choosing a ball. For players 12 years and older, including adults, the size 5 is recommended. Younger players should use smaller sizes appropriate for their age. Leather for natural grass surfaces and synthetic materials on rougher surfaces are the best options. Additionally, thermal-bonded footballs offer better waterproofing and shape retention compared to stitched options. Durability is also an important characteristic to check.

Why do football players need to wear shinguards?

Shin guards should be a part of every footballer’s equipment as they protect the lower legs from injury when tackles or collisions occur. The shin guards protect the lower legs from injuries such as fractures and severe bruises. The football governing bodies enforce the wearing of shinguards to ensure player safety.

Can the choice of socks impact a football player’s performance?

Absolutely. Football socks protect and support the player’s foot during intense play. They provide cushioning, help keep shin guards secure, reduce friction and prevent blisters. The right pair of socks can enhance a football player’s comfort and indirectly affect their performance.

How to Choose the Best Protective Gear for Football

Protective gear is an essential part of any football player’s kit bag. Assess each piece for comfort, safety, and compatibility with the player’s position. It is essential to wear mouthguards for the sake of protecting your teeth and reducing risk of concussion. Padded underwear provides extra cushioning, especially for goalkeepers. Sleeves can help with compression and provide minor abrasion resistance. All equipment should be in compliance with league safety regulations and properly certified.
